13F-HR: PNC Financial Discloses Q4 2025 Equity Holdings

Sentiment:

Holdings Report


PNC Financial Services Group, Inc. has filed its Q4 2025 Form 13F-HR, detailing its substantial equity and options holdings totaling over $166 billion across 17,135 positions.

Summary

  • PNC Financial Services Group, Inc. submitted its Form 13F-HR for the calendar quarter ended December 31, 2025.
  • The report details the institutional investment manager's holdings, which collectively represent a total market value of $166,632,001,599.
  • The filing encompasses 17,135 individual securities positions.
  • The report includes holdings managed by four other entities: PNC Bank, National Association; PNC Delaware Trust Company; PNC Ohio Trust Company; and PNC Wealth Management LLC.

Industry Context

StockSavvy.ai notes that Form 13F-HR filings are standard quarterly disclosures for institutional investment managers with over $100 million in qualifying assets. These reports provide transparency into the equity market activities of major players like PNC Financial Services Group, offering insights into their portfolio allocations and investment preferences, which can influence market sentiment and inform other investors.
